Martin C. Wapenaar is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Genetics and Gastroenterology. According to data from OpenAlex, Martin C. Wapenaar has authored 45 papers receiving a total of 2.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 29 papers in Molecular Biology, 18 papers in Genetics and 13 papers in Gastroenterology. Recurrent topics in Martin C. Wapenaar’s work include Celiac Disease Research and Management (13 papers), Muscle Physiology and Disorders (11 papers) and C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(7 papers). Martin C. Wapenaar is often cited by papers focused on Celiac Disease Research and Management (13 papers), Muscle Physiology and Disorders (11 papers) and C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(7 papers). Martin C. Wapenaar collaborates with scholars based in The Netherlands, United States and United Kingdom. Martin C. Wapenaar's co-authors include Cisca Wijmenga, G.J.B. van Ommen, P. Pearson, Andrea Ballabio and Egbert Bakker and has published in prestigious journ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, Nature Genetics and Gastroenterology.
